Crucial evidence for a car accident case includes the official police report, which details the initial findings. Photos and videos of the accident scene, including vehicle damage and road conditions, are very important. Witness statements can provide objective accounts of what happened. Finally, comprehensive medical records and bills are essential to document the extent of your injuries and their impact.
You should avoid admitting fault or speculating about the cause of the accident before all facts are gathered. Do not downplay your injuries or discuss your case with anyone other than your attorney or their staff. It's also best not to sign any documents from the insurance company without your attorney's review. Stick to providing factual information to the licensed pros.
Most personal injury lawyers work on a contingency fee basis. This means they only get paid if they win your case, taking a percentage of the settlement or award, typically between 30-40%. Truck accident lawyers specialize in cases involving large commercial vehicles. These accidents often have more severe consequences and involve complex federal regulations and multiple liable parties (e.g., trucking companies, manufacturers). Truck accident lawyers possess specific knowledge to investigate these intricate cases and pursue maximum compensation for victims.
